高铜低铁硫化铜精矿预浸出-焙烧-酸浸试验研究  被引量:2

Experimental Study on Pre-leaching-Roasting-Acid Leaching of Copper Sulfide Concentrate with High Copper and Low Iron

摘  要:针对某高铜低铁硫化铜精矿,本文开展预浸出-焙烧-酸浸试验研究。结果表明,硫化铜精矿在硫酸用量0.35 t/t矿、温度28℃、浸出时间2.0 h、液固比2∶1的条件下预浸出,预浸渣率为75%;主要元素铜浸出率为29.62%,钴浸出率为40.00%,铁浸出率为45.45%,镁浸出率为16.21%;酸浸渣硫含量为13.67%,相比原料硫化铜精矿的硫含量(9.99%),明显升高。预浸渣在750℃下焙烧2.0 h,焙烧脱硫率约为75%。焙砂采用酸浸,铜总浸出率约为98%,焙砂浸出液含铁约0.1 g/L,含镁约1.4 g/L。对于使用该工艺流程处理得到的浸出液,铁、镁离子的浓度满足直接电积要求。Aiming at a copper sulfide concentrate with high copper and low iron,a pre-leaching-roasting-acid leaching test is carried out in this paper.The results show that the copper sulfide concentrate is pre-leached under the conditions of sulfuric acid dosage of 0.35 t/t ore,temperature of 28℃,leaching time of 2.0 h,and liquid-solid ratio of 2∶1,and the pre-leaching slag rate is about 75%;the main element copper leaching rate is 29.62%,cobalt leaching rate is 40.00%,iron leaching rate is 45.45%,and magnesium leaching rate is 16.21%;the sulfur content of the acid leaching residue is 13.67%,which is significantly higher than that of the raw copper sulfide concentrate(9.99%).The prepreg is calcined at 750℃for 2.0 h,and the calcination desulfurization rate is about 75%.The calcine is acid leached,and the total copper leaching rate is about 98%,the calcine leaching solution contains about 0.1 g/L of iron and 1.4 g/L of magnesium.For the leachate obtained by using this process flow,the concentrations of iron and magnesium ions meet the requirements of direct electrowinning.
